Maintenance Tips for Long-Lasting Rubber Seal Performance

A rubber seal requires proper upkeep to maintain its function. Regular inspection can detect early signs of wear, including compression set or cracks. Lubrication and cleaning prevent damage from chemicals or debris.

Testing for tensile strength and compression ensures the seal withstands operational pressures without failure. For fluid transfer, automotive, or mechanical systems, adhering to maintenance guidelines preserves the rubber seal’s effectiveness, ensuring long-term operational stability and reliable sealing performance.
